A Good Pair of Napoleon III Bronze Urns with Covers After Claude Michel Clodion c.1870 sub-Antiques this Gabbeh is a versatileOrigin: French Period: 2nd Empire Provenance: Unknown Date: c. 1870 Height: 15. 25 inches Width: 9 inches The fine pair of late nineteenth century French bronze urns decorated overall in the manner of Clodion, the lid finials cast as reclining amorini, each with lift out liners and twin handles cast as fruiting vines, the friezes with further cavorting putti in relief, with waisted and fluted undersides standing on ebonised wooden plinths bases.
